Job Title: Graduate Marketing and Communications Assistant (Two Year Contract) Reporting to: Head of Marketing & Communications Location: Royal Dublin Society, Ballsbridge, Dublin 4 Closing Date: January 19th, **** About the RDS The Royal Dublin Society (RDS), established in ****, is a philanthropic organisation driving Ireland's economic and cultural progress.
With a legacy of nearly 300 years, the RDS is known for its diverse programmes across agriculture, arts, industry, science, and enterprise.
In addition to its philanthropic work, the RDS also operates as a premier venue, hosting a wide range of events, conferences, and exhibitions, within its expansive 43-acre estate in the heart of Dublin.
As a foundation and social impact organisation, the RDS invests in initiatives that address contemporary challenges, support innovation, and promote sustainable growth, ensuring a lasting positive impact on Irish society.
